MARDAN: Mother gets child’s custody

Published January 15, 2007

MARDAN, Jan 14: Hearing a habeas corpus petition, District and Sessions Judge of Mardan Syed Yahya Zahid Gillani ordered that the custody of a nine-year-old child be given to his mother.

Dr Khalid had forcibly taken away the child from the house of his mother-in-law, where his wife, Dr Asmat, was living after the couple developed differences over a property dispute.

Dr Asmat and her mother had lodged an FIR against Dr Khalid under sections 34, 354, 452 and 48 PPC with the Hoti police station.
